Question 954016: Please help me out. I think I have the concept just cant grasp it... here it is..
If the quotient of a number and 4 is added to 1/2 the result is 3/4 find the number.

x=the number
x%2F4%2B1%2F2=3%2F4 Subtract 1/2 from each side.
x%2F4=1%2F4 Multiply each side by 4.
x=1 ANSWER: The number is 1.
